Will It Hurt?
Pain is almost always on the list of patients’ fears. Here’s the good news: laser surgery is typically far less painful than traditional surgical methods requiring metal surgical instruments. Most procedures use topical anesthetics or cooling technologies to minimize discomfort. Post-procedure, it’s common to experience minor soreness or redness, but these symptoms are often temporary and manageable.
Is Recovery Difficult?
Recovery time is another source of apprehension. While it depends on the procedure, laser surgeries involve shorter recovery periods than traditional surgeries in many instances. Typically, treatments such as skin resurfacing or tattoo removal allow patients to return to regular activities within days. For more intensive procedures, the doctor will provide personalized aftercare instructions to make recovery as smooth as possible.
